Firmware update channel: Brindlecore devices poll the Ostrel update service every 6h over mTLS. Channel manifests are signed with the Ostrel release key; devices reject unsigned or downgraded builds. Staged rollout: canary ring (2%), then fleet. Rollback requires a signed revert manifest approved by two release owners. The updater daemon authenticates to the internal manifest registry with a service credential scoped to read-only manifest pulls, rotated quarterly. For review purposes, the current registry credential is provided below.

API key for yahig-tadup: kto7_ubizbYm

## Env Vars: ProfileShard Rollout

Quick reference for the release manager before we flip on sharding for the Lumette user-profile store. ProfileShard splits profiles across eight partitions using consistent hashing; SHARD_COUNT and SHARD_RING_SEED must match across every app node or lookups will silently miss. Don't change the seed mid-rollout — seriously, that's a rebalance-everything event. The shard coordinator also needs to authenticate to the Verran partition registry, and its credential should sit on the line right after this one:

sealed setting: ARCHIVE_KEY3=202

Hello plugin authors,

Next Thursday, Corbexa will run a disaster-recovery drill for the RestockRoute vending-machine restock planner. During the failover window, plugin callbacks will be replayed against the standby scheduler, so please ensure your handlers are idempotent and tolerate duplicate route assignments. No customer restock data will be altered. To re-register your plugin against the standby environment during the drill, authenticate with the recovery passphrase provided below.

vault phrase of hahip-tajeg = quenax-briath-briax

## Further reading

The session-token refresh bug in Larkspire v2.3 caused silent logouts when refresh requests raced a token rotation. The fix in v2.4 serializes rotation, but maintainers touching the auth layer should understand the original failure mode before refactoring. The full incident writeup, with timelines and reproduction steps, is kept on the page below.

dashboard of yahaf-kajep = https://jira.zemvarsys.internal/display/projects/browse/browse/a08b